The electrode component is delivered through the next jugular vein and then it's guided through the largest vein inside the head. It's near the brain region that's activated with voluntary movement. The IRTU component is implanted underneath the skin of the collarbone. And this part of the interface wirelessly transmits signals from the cortex to another component that's taped onto the skin surface.
